NFBLibrary 2026/01
Acompanhe as novidades de cada liberação da versão
Veja também:
NFBLibrary 2026/01 – Beta
01/06/2026
Anunciamos a liberação da versão Beta da NFBLibrary 2026/01.
Confira aqui a lista completa das novidades desta versão.
Abaixo o que mudou entre a versão Alpha 4 e Beta
- Adicionada nova função NFBCancelar, usada para cancelar uma NFS-e autorizada.
- Adicionado, na view DPS.vw da workspace de exemplo, exemplo de como implementar a função NFBCancelar.
- Adicionado, na view DPS.vw da workspace de exemplo, campos para realizar o cancelamento por substituição.
- Adicionada nova função NFBConsultarConvenio, usada para consultar os convênios de um município com o ambiente nacional.
- Adicionada, na workspace de exemplo, a view ConsultarConvenios.vw, com exemplo de como implementar a função NFBConsultarConvenio.
- Adicionada nova função NFBDistribuicaoDFe, usada para recuperar a lista de documentos fiscais relacionados a um CPF/CNPJ.
- Adicionada, na workspace de exemplo, a view DistribuicaoDFeServico.vw, com exemplo de como implementar a função NFBDistribuicaoDFe.
- Adicionada nova função NFBLerXMLAutorizado, usada para ler o XML da NFS-e no padrão nacional e retornar as informações em uma estrutura.
- Adicionada, na workspace de exemplo, a view LerXMLAutorizado.vw, com exemplo de como implementar a função NFBLerXMLAutorizado.
- Adicionada nova função NFBPegarNomeCertificado, usada para obter o nome de um certificado selecionado pelo usuário entre os certificados válidos instalados na máquina.
- Adicionada, na workspace de exemplo, a view PegaNomeCertificado.vw, com exemplo de como implementar a função NFBPegarNomeCertificado.
- Adicionada nova função NFBValidarCNPJ, usada para verificar se o CNPJ, numérico ou alfanumérico, informado é válido.
- Adicionada, na workspace de exemplo, a view ValidarCNPJ.vw, com exemplo de como implementar a função NFBValidarCNPJ.
- Corrigido na função NFBGerarXMLDPS, o nome da tag “cMunDocFiscal” do grupo gDocumentos[iContador].gDocFiscalOutro que estava sendo gerada como “tipoChaveDFe”.
NFBLibrary 2026/01 – Alpha 4
24/12/2025
Anunciamos a liberação da versão Alpha 4 da NFBLibrary 2026/01.
Confira aqui a lista completa das novidades desta versão.
Abaixo o que mudou entre a versão Alpha 3 e Alpha 4
- Adicionada validação do caminho onde o arquivo PFX do certificado digital está localizado. Esta validação tem a finalidade de tratar o erro 4399 “Erro ao invocar o método COM The system cannot find the file specified.”, que ocorre quando o certificado não é localizado no local informado.
- Adicionado tratamento aos erros do protocolo HTTP, que quando ocorria na função NFBGerarDANFSe, salvava um PDF inválido e não retornava o erro ocorrido.
- Corrigido, na função NFBRecepcionarDPS, o erro “-6 Value cannot be null. Parameter name: certificate”, ao tentar ler o certificado digital quando este era informado via parâmetro.
- Corrigida, na função NFBGerarXMLDPS, a geração no nó “infoCompl” que causava o erro, “erro ao inserir elemento ‘infoCompl’ no documento XML!”.
- NFBLibrary passa a ser compatível com ambiente 64 bits.
- Adicionado, na função NFBGerarDANFSe, o parâmetro iTpAmb, onde deverá ser informado o ambiente que deseja realizar a consulta, sendo: 1-produção ou 2-homologação (produção restrita).
NFBLibrary 2026/01 – Alpha 3
17/12/2025
Anunciamos a liberação da versão Alpha 3 da NFBLibrary 2026/01.
Confira aqui a lista completa das novidades desta versão.
Abaixo o que mudou entre a versão Alpha 2 e Alpha 3
- Alterado, nos pacotes NFBColocaZerosEsquerda.pkg, NFBConverteNumberDataFlexParaNFe.pkg, NFBDestroiObjetoCom.pkg, NFBExcluirArquivo.pkg, NFBRemoveCaracteresEspeciais.pkg e NFBTestaArquivo.pkg, o nome das funções, para evitar erros de compilação causados por conflitos de nomes com as outras Libraries.
- Alterada, nas funções NFBGerarDANFSe, NFBGerarXMLDPS e NFBRecepcionarDPS, a chamada das funções que tiveram seus nomes alterados, para evitar conflito com outras Libraries.
- Corrigido um problema que ocorria ao ler o parâmetro do certificado digital que causava o erro “Erro ao invocar método do objeto com…”. Este erro só ocorria quando era informada a string representando o certificado digital.
- Alterada, na função NFBGerarXMLDPS, a geração do nó “regApTribSN” do grupo “regTrib”, que passou a ser opcional a partir da versão 1.01 do schema.
NFBLibrary 2026/01 – Alpha 2
12/12/2025
Anunciamos a liberação da versão Alpha 2 da NFBLibrary 2026/01.
Confira aqui a lista completa das novidades desta versão.
Abaixo o que mudou entre a versão Alpha e Alpha 2
- Corrigido nome da estrutura tNFBRecepcaoDPSErrosAlertas, que estava tNFBRecepcaoDPSErrosAlestas;
- Corrigido, na estrutura tNFBRecepcaoDPSRetorno, nome da variável vtErrosAlertas, que estava vtErrosAletas;
- Adicionados os campos referentes a RTC (versão 1.01 do schema);
- Adicionado tratamento nos campos de CNPJ, CPF e CEP para remover separadores e, nos campos String, remover espaços vazios;
- Adicionado, na workspace de exemplo, campo ncNBS, que passa a ser obrigatório;
- Adicionado, na workspace de exemplo, campo para armazenar o resultado do envio do XML;
- Alterados, na estrutura da NFBLibrary, o tipo e o nome do campo scNBS, que passa a ser do tipo numérico e nome ncNBS;
- Corrigida, na função NFBGerarXMLDPS, a geração do nó “pAliq” do grupo “tribMun”, gerava o erro “mensagem inválida MSG_ADDELEMENTNS”.
- Corrigida, na função NFBGerarXMLDPS, a geração da tag “xLgr” dos nós “gToma” e “interm”.
- Corrigida, na função NFBPreparaDPSExemploById, a informação do campo “vtDPS.dhEmi”, que estava passando a hora errada.
NFBLibrary 2026/01 – Alpha
10/11/2025
Anunciamos a liberação da versão Alpha da NFBLibrary 2026/01.
Confira aqui a lista completa das novidades desta versão.
Links rápidos
©Acronsoft, 2026. Todos os direitos reservados.
